These are the video timings
• Ignition: 1.9 seconds
• Flameout: ~~ 5 seconds
• Splash: 17.9 seconds.
• Explosion sound: 23.5 seconds.
• Speed of sound @ 600m : ~337 m/s
My player sound delay < 0.2 seconds (sound after video)
So derived figures.
• Burn time: 3 seconds
• Flight time: 16 seconds
• Splash-to-bang: 5.6 seconds
• Calculated distance to impact: 1887m
• Average ground speed: 117 m/s

Standard GRAD
Total mass 66kg
Warhead mass 19.1 kg
Motor & nozzle mass 47kg
Propellant mass 20.45kg
Motor total impulse 39700
Motor specific impulse 1940
Motor with standard warhead 2875 mm
Motor & Nozzle 1860 mm
As we see burn time is 3 seconds so it should be easy to generate a motor file if you don't have one.
